The Role
This is a hands-on, end-to-end recruitment role for someone who wants genuine ownership. Reporting to the Head of People and working closely with the Senior Leadership Team, you will manage all aspects of our hiring activity across a critical 12-month period while also contributing to the longer-term people brand and attraction strategy.
The role is fixed-term for 12 months. Where business need and performance support it, we expect there to be the possibility of a permanent position.
Key Deliverables
End-to-end recruitment
- Own the full recruitment cycle for all live roles: briefing, attraction, screening, interview coordination, offer management, and pre-boarding.
- Partner with Head of People to agree role briefs, interview formats, and selection criteria before each campaign opens.
- Provide regular status updates to the Head of People and SLT.
- Deliver on targeted recruitment into the legal team in FY27, supported by the firm’s phased hiring plan.
Supplier and agency relationship management
- Manage the firm’s preferred supplier list (PSL), ensuring terms remain commercially sound and performance is tracked against agreed SLAs.
Colleague Referral Programme
- Lead internal communications and campaign activity for the Colleague Referral Bonus Scheme, working with the Head of People to keep colleague engagement high.
- Track referral submissions, coordinate eligibility confirmation, and liaise with payroll on bonus processing.
- Report monthly on referral pipeline contribution and make recommendations for scheme improvements.
Employer brand and attraction
- Support the development and execution of IDR Law’s employer brand strategy, translating our culture, career pathways, and values into compelling candidate-facing content.
- Contribute to careers content across LinkedIn and other relevant channels, using candidate intelligence and interview feedback to sharpen our positioning.
- Work with the Head of People and external partners on targeted direct sourcing campaigns for hard-to-fill roles.
Person Specification
Essential
- Demonstrable experience managing end-to-end recruitment, either in-house or in a 360 agency environment.
- Strong stakeholder management skills: able to brief hiring managers confidently, push back constructively, and keep multiple processes moving at pace.
- Organised and data-literate: comfortable tracking pipelines, producing reports, and using insight to drive decisions.
- Clear, professional written communication: able to draft job adverts, internal campaign copy, and candidate correspondence to a high standard.
- Collaborative approach with a practical, can-do mindset suited to a growing, fast-moving firm.
Desirable
- Experience recruiting qualified lawyers or other regulated professionals.
- Familiarity with legal sector salary benchmarking and market intelligence sources.
- Experience managing or contributing to employer brand or talent marketing activity.
- Exposure to RPO or third-party agency management, including commercial negotiation.
- Knowledge of relevant employment legislation, including the Employment Rights Act 2025 reforms.
